Comment #2 on issue 1209 by tdanielsmusic: beatLength is no longer used, but still appears in regression tests converted from xml
http://code.google.com/p/lilypond/issues/detail?id=1209

I tracked the failing regression tests down. It's not that easy. Definitely not frog. They're caused by four files generated on the fly from ..regression/musicxml/

The files containing the xml source are:
  11c-TimeSignatures-CompoundSimple.xml
  11d-TimeSignatures-CompoundMultiple.xml
  11e-TimeSignatures-CompoundMixed.xml
  11f-TimeSignatures-SymbolMeaning.xml

I guess Reinhold will need to look into this.

In addition, there is one snippet which sets beamLength four times (hence the confusion):

Documentation/snippets/changing-the-time-signature-without-affecting-the-beaming.ly

I'll raise a new issue for this.
